How much do associate web designer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 24, 2026, the average hourly pay for associate web designer in Fresno, CA is $34.76,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$25.53 and $38.17 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an associate web designer do?

An Associate Web Designer is responsible for assisting in the creation, design, and maintenance of websites under the guidance of senior designers. They work on tasks like designing web page layouts, updating content, optimizing user experience, and ensuring sites are visually appealing and functional. Typically, they collaborate with developers, content creators, and other team members to meet project goals and client requirements. This entry-level position is ideal for building foundational skills in web design and gaining hands-on experience with industry-standard tools and technologies.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an associate web designer?

To thrive as an Associate Web Designer, you need a foundational understanding of HTML, CSS, basic JavaScript, and a portfolio showcasing your design abilities, often supported by a degree or certification in web design or a related field. Familiarity with design tools such as Adobe Creative Suite, Figma, and content management systems like WordPress is typically required. Creativity, attention to detail, collaboration, and effective communication are standout soft skills in this role. These skills ensure visually appealing, user-friendly websites and smooth teamwork, which are critical for delivering successful digital projects.

What is the difference between Associate Web Designer vs Web Developer?

AspectAssociate Web DesignerWeb Developer
CredentialsTypically an associate degree or certificate in web design or related fieldOften requires a degree in computer science, software engineering, or related field
Work EnvironmentDesign teams, creative agencies, marketing departmentsDevelopment teams, IT departments, software firms
Primary FocusDesigning visual layouts, user interfaces, and graphicsWriting code, building website functionality, backend development
Tools & SkillsAdobe Creative Suite, HTML, CSS, basic JavaScriptJavaScript, PHP, frameworks, database management

While both roles involve working on websites, Associate Web Designers focus on visual design and user experience, whereas Web Developers handle coding and technical implementation. Understanding these differences helps in choosing the right career path or job search focus.
